PURPOSE: To obtain an organ-storing device capable of surely judging the storage state by providing with a means for feeding a perfusate containing marked adenosine triphosphate into a circuit, a means for sampling the perfusate after passed through the organ and means for measuring the concentration of the adenosine triphosphate in the used perfusate. n CONSTITUTION: A perfusate 9 containing marked adenosine triphosphate(ATP) is flown in a closed circuit continuing from a reservoir 8 to a pump 2, a bubble trap 3 and an organ 4 in a storing chamber 5. When the storage state of the organ 4 is measured, the first three-way stopcock 6 and the second stopcock 10 are actuated to flow the perfusate 9a containing a specified concentration of fluorescent ATP from a tank 25 into the first branching way 7 through the third branching way 11, the pump 2 and the organ 4. The concentration of the fluorescent ATP is measured between the bubble trap 3 and the storing chamber 5 and the concentration of the fluorescent ATP after passed the organ is also measured with a cell for measuring the fluorescence, thereby knowing the storage state of the organ 4 from the measured results on the decrease degree of the ATP. The device permits to surely judge the storage state of the organ without relating to a difference between individual organs. n COPYRIGHT: (C)1990,JPO&Japio |
